Background:
EIF3J (eukaryotic translation initiation factor 3 subunit J) encodes a core subunit of the eukaryotic initiation factor 3 complex, which participates in the initiation of translation by aiding in the recruitment of protein and mRNA components to the 40S ribosome. There are pseudogenes for EIF3J on chromosomes 1, 3, and 9. Alternative splicing results in multiple transcript variants encoding different isoforms.
